|
Использование SQLite в локальной сети.
|
|||
---|---|---|---|
#18+
Интересует опыт использования SQLite в локальной сети. Интересует надежность, количество одновременно работающих пользователей, скорость обработки запросов. База небольшая около 15 таблиц от 10 до 30000 записей (в зависимости от таблиц). Также интересуют подводные камни при реализации. Всем спасибо за ответы! ... |
|||
:
Нравится:
Не нравится:
|
|||
30.03.2012, 09:34 |
|
Использование SQLite в локальной сети.
|
|||
---|---|---|---|
#18+
Вы вообще о чём? ... |
|||
:
Нравится:
Не нравится:
|
|||
30.03.2012, 10:18 |
|
Использование SQLite в локальной сети.
|
|||
---|---|---|---|
#18+
metosВы вообще о чём? Насколько я понимаю SQLite позиционируется как локальная, настольная СУБД. Вот вопрос и возник, можно ли использовать данную СУБД в многопользовательском режиме? Не точно выразился видимо. ... |
|||
:
Нравится:
Не нравится:
|
|||
30.03.2012, 10:44 |
|
Использование SQLite в локальной сети.
|
|||
---|---|---|---|
#18+
... |
|||
:
Нравится:
Не нравится:
|
|||
30.03.2012, 10:47 |
|
Использование SQLite в локальной сети.
|
|||
---|---|---|---|
#18+
metos, Интересно, кто нибудь, на практике использует sqliteserver продукты указанные данной http://sqlite.org/cvstrac/wiki?p=SqliteNetwork ... |
|||
:
Нравится:
Не нравится:
|
|||
09.04.2012, 04:54 |
|
Использование SQLite в локальной сети.
|
|||
---|---|---|---|
#18+
ev-kov, Присоединяюсь к вопросу! ... |
|||
:
Нравится:
Не нравится:
|
|||
20.12.2012, 16:50 |
|
Использование SQLite в локальной сети.
|
|||
---|---|---|---|
#18+
Использую встроенные в свои серверные процессы и в AOL Server. Кстати, непосредственно в исходниках эскулайт есть пример демона (на С). ... |
|||
:
Нравится:
Не нравится:
|
|||
21.12.2012, 14:20 |
|
Использование SQLite в локальной сети.
|
|||
---|---|---|---|
#18+
ev-kovmetos, Интересно, кто нибудь, на практике использует sqliteserver продукты указанные данной http://sqlite.org/cvstrac/wiki?p=SqliteNetwork а смысл? не проще ли взять какой-нибудь экспресс сервер баз, например sql server 2012 и не тратить время на изобретение велосипеда ... |
|||
:
Нравится:
Не нравится:
|
|||
23.12.2012, 15:44 |
|
Использование SQLite в локальной сети.
|
|||
---|---|---|---|
#18+
Winnipuh, экспресс имеет ограничения. Мне тоже интересно, можно ли использовать Lite дома, но так, чтобы к ней доступ имели одновременно 2-3 процесса? ... |
|||
:
Нравится:
Не нравится:
|
|||
13.05.2013, 15:59 |
|
Использование SQLite в локальной сети.
|
|||
---|---|---|---|
#18+
Вроде-ж все уже обсуждалось в поиске: Несколько (5-7) локальных процессов работать могут и так, и через включенный WAL. Несколько (2-3) сетевых клиентов могут работать через файловый доступ. Нужно грамотно выставить таймауты. ... |
|||
:
Нравится:
Не нравится:
|
|||
20.05.2013, 12:49 |
|
Использование SQLite в локальной сети.
|
|||
---|---|---|---|
#18+
ev-kovmetos, Интересно, кто нибудь, на практике использует sqliteserver продукты указанные данной http://sqlite.org/cvstrac/wiki?p=SqliteNetwork в рекламе написано шо да, используют REAL SQL Server ( http://www.realsoftware.com/realsqlserver/) http://sqlabs.com/cubesql.php cubeSQL is based on SQLite, the most popular embedded database engine used by Google, Sun Microsystems, McAfee, Mozilla Firefox and Apple. SQLite is based on the SQL language standard, so if you know SQL you already know how to query cubeSQL. SQLiteServer ( http://sqliteserver.xhost.ro/index.html) загнулся ... |
|||
:
Нравится:
Не нравится:
|
|||
30.05.2013, 12:22 |
|
Использование SQLite в локальной сети.
|
|||
---|---|---|---|
#18+
defragmentatorWinnipuh, экспресс имеет ограничения. Мне тоже интересно, можно ли использовать Lite дома, но так, чтобы к ней доступ имели одновременно 2-3 процесса? принципиально можно, ну как с аксесссом например, или файлом. Блокировать, разблокирвоать, транзакции... Но я снова об SQL Server: А что 10 Гб мало для базы в SQL Express? Т.е. ваша SQLite база будет где-то такая же. Но что будет с производительностью, если с таким файлом будут работать по сети много приложений? Да и что это будет за работа. Ведь получается, что скажем к SQL Server коннектятся приложенрия по сети, но сам-то он работает с базой локально, а тут наоборот.... ... |
|||
:
Нравится:
Не нравится:
|
|||
01.06.2013, 08:49 |
|
Использование SQLite в локальной сети.
|
|||
---|---|---|---|
#18+
Ну если я отвечу что по оределению это не может быть так же надежно как серверный вариант с сервером заточенным под многопользовательский доступ. Вы мне поверите? Вы лучше просветите насчет другого: что может дать скулайт, чего нет в PostgreSQL или тем более в MongoDB? ... |
|||
:
Нравится:
Не нравится:
|
|||
07.06.2013, 23:04 |
|
Использование SQLite в локальной сети.
|
|||
---|---|---|---|
#18+
apapacyНу если я отвечу что по оределению это не может быть так же надежно как серверный вариант с сервером заточенным под многопользовательский доступ. Вы мне поверите? "По определению" - это отмазка студента-двоечника, который не знает, о чем говорит, но надеется, что вдруг есть какое-то подходящее определение, известное собеседнику :) apapacyВы лучше просветите насчет другого: что может дать скулайт, чего нет в PostgreSQL или тем более в MongoDB? На оффсайте ясно написано: "Small. Fast. Reliable. Choose any three.". Вот именно сочетание трех этих факторов и ценно. Для специалистов еще много всего - подключение внешних источников данных как таблиц (только в последних постгресах появилось), отсутствие администрирования, возможность записи во view (в постгресе не помню, допилили ли это хотя бы в новых версиях) и проч. Полнотекстовый поиск в эскулайт очень хорош - быстрый, способен работать с огромными объемами данных (сам я тестировал до четверти терабайта на таблицу, нужно было для некоторых проектов), в то время как в постгресе FTS недоделан и требует лишних обращений к таблице вместо работы только с индексом (кажется, кто-то из разработчиков постгреса над этим работает давно и пока без видимых результатов). Думается мне, MongoDB здесь упомянут вообще "не в тему" - по отзывам, и тормозит и данные на ровном месте теряет, "живые" отзывы вполне соответствуют тому, что об опыте эксплуатации этой фигни пишут на форумах (к примеру, на хабре про нагруженные проекты на MongoDB есть). Полнотекстовый поиск в MongoDB только-только появился, стеммер там единственный (Портера) и для нас малополезен, скорость аховая. Кроме как нативной поддержки JSON и яваскрипт, ничего хорошего. ... |
|||
:
Нравится:
Не нравится:
|
|||
08.06.2013, 21:26 |
|
Использование SQLite в локальной сети.
|
|||
---|---|---|---|
#18+
apapacyНу если я отвечу что по оределению это не может быть так же надежно как серверный вариант с сервером заточенным под многопользовательский доступ. Вы мне поверите? Вы лучше просветите насчет другого: что может дать скулайт, чего нет в PostgreSQL или тем более в MongoDB ? в кучу кони, люди, мухи и котлеты.... а Монго тут каким боком? ... |
|||
:
Нравится:
Не нравится:
|
|||
11.06.2013, 14:32 |
|
Использование SQLite в локальной сети.
|
|||
---|---|---|---|
#18+
На мой взгляд MongoDB наиболее перспективная неСиквел база данных, прежде всего потому что использует встроенный Ява-скрипт как для хранения данных, так и для выполнения серверных скриптов. Что касается SQLite - то я не являясь пользователем этого продукта действительно искренно (без тени подвоха) спросил - а зачем городить серверный Скулайт, если он был заточен под выполнение как встроенное приложение. На мой взгляд, серверный Скулайт может быть после того как получит широкую поддержку сообщества и многолетнюю обкатку на реальных приложениях. Кстати МонгоДБ этого пока тоже не хватает. Я реально работал с несколькими серверами (конкретно Interbase, MSDE2000 Release 5, PostgreSQL, MySQL). По крайней мере три первых успешно восстанавливались после разнообразных и неизбежных сбоев (вполть до грубого выключения компа клавишей OFF) На мой, обратно же взгляд, все преимущества серверного Скулайта будут иметь весьма относительную ценность, если для восстановления после сбоев необходимо будет делать нечто большее чем просто включить компьютер. ... |
|||
:
Нравится:
Не нравится:
|
|||
16.06.2013, 16:38 |
|
Использование SQLite в локальной сети.
|
|||
---|---|---|---|
#18+
apapacyНа мой взгляд MongoDB наиболее перспективная неСиквел база данных... Флейм. apapacyЯ реально работал с несколькими серверами (конкретно Interbase, MSDE2000 Release 5, PostgreSQL, MySQL). По крайней мере три первых успешно восстанавливались после разнообразных и неизбежных сбоев (вполть до грубого выключения компа клавишей OFF) Страшный "сбой", все читающие должны ужаснуться, не иначе. apapacyНа мой, обратно же взгляд, все преимущества серверного Скулайта будут иметь весьма относительную ценность, если для восстановления после сбоев необходимо будет делать нечто большее чем просто включить компьютер. Каким образом СУБД при включении компьютера восстановит развалившийся рейд, к примеру? ... |
|||
:
Нравится:
Не нравится:
|
|||
17.06.2013, 19:20 |
|
|
start [/forum/topic.php?fid=54&msg=37730884&tid=2008895]: |
0ms |
get settings: |
11ms |
get forum list: |
14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
32ms |
get topic data: |
9ms |
get forum data: |
2ms |
get page messages: |
56ms |
get tp. blocked users: |
1ms |
others: | 16ms |
total: | 149ms |
0 / 0 |